Congregación Hidalgo, Veracruz de Ignacio de la Llave, Mexico

Overview

Congregación Hidalgo is a small, peaceful town in Veracruz set amid lush countryside and tranquil riverside settings. Known for its tight knit community, local markets, and serene atmosphere, it's an authentic spot to experience rural Mexican life.

Best Time to Visit

November to March for mild weather and fewer rain showers.

Local Tips

Bring cash as ATMs and card acceptance are limited; public transport options are basic so consider renting a car for convenience.

Cultural Etiquette

Tipping 10-15% is customary at restaurants. Dress modestly, especially when visiting religious sites or community events, and greet locals with a friendly hello.

Safety Warnings

Stay cautious after dark in quieter outskirts like Las Lomas, and beware of petty theft in crowded market areas. Town is generally safe but avoid isolated nature trails at night.

Hidden Gems

Enjoy early morning walks along the Río San Juan, visit family-run bakeries for homemade pan dulce, and spend an afternoon at the weekly local crafts market.
